Transaction d25840c81336ee64ff080ed876be807060675ae81be18009e380f4bde36bb562
1 Input
1 Output
-
d25840c81336ee64ff080ed876be807060675ae81be18009e380f4bde36bb562:0
- value
- 178029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72f6335830c0641cda07602d73f3b7a779fc7195 OP_EQUAL
- address
- 3CAstj9ftXiJnQe4oGWQzAHVLSqAJZiUE8